
10 Tips to Build Trust in Your Website or Blog
You only have one chance to make a first impression so if your website does not instill a sense of trust with your visitors, your online business will never be successful.
Trust can is built by a number of small actions that you can implement of your entire website, here are 10 tips I would recommend.
- Website Design – Make sure that your website looks professional and that it is relevant it is to the subject matter.
- Clear Navigation -Make your website’s navigation is easy to follow to ensure that your visitors don’t get confused. Anything that you want a customer to see or experience should be up front and no more than two clicks away.
- Use Quality Content- Write your articles for human readers, not search engines. Follow the HEART rule of creating good content; Honest, Exclusive, Accurate, Relevant and Timely.
- Keep Your Website Current -Regularly add new content to your site that will actively engage your audience.
- Use Images of Trust-Piggyback off of reputable brands, if you accept credit cards use images of Mastercard, Visa, American Express on every page. If you’re a member of the Better Business Bureau use the BBB Logo.
- Publish Real Testimonials-Use real testimonials and third party endorsements, use real names and link to websites when possible.
- Publish a telephone number and real address-Your contact page should provide a e-mail form, a telephone number and a mailing address.
- Publish Your Guarantee and Return Policy – Consider having a 100% money-back guarantee and clearly state your refund and return policies.
- Only Ask for Information You Need-For example if you have an e-mail newsletter the only thing you really need is the customers e-mail address, so that is all you should request.
- Case Studies -Publish case studies of clients that you have helped, used your product.
The next time you visit a website ask yourself, would I trust purchasing something this site? Then ask yourself why or why not.
